About the role

  • Salary from $80,937.21 (pro-rata) plus super

As the First Nations Employment Pathways Officer, you will contribute to Council’s Reconciliation Action Plan delivery by supporting the development and implementation of employment and professional development opportunities for First Nations peoples at Wyndham Council.

In this role, you will have the opportunity to help grow the number of First Nations identified roles and people working within Wyndham Council and strengthen Wyndham Council as an employer of choice.

 

What you’ll deliver

  • Support First Nations recruitment, retention and professional development.
  • Successful development and delivery of Wyndham’s First Nations Traineeship program, in collaboration with partners and management.
  • Facilitation and administration of Council’s Aboriginal Staff Inclusion Group.
  • Research best practice and propose recommendations to management for consideration.
  • Contribute to the development and delivery of Strategy.

 

What you’ll bring

  • Experience delivering First Nations employment initiatives or other programs that advance the rights and outcomes of First Nations peoples
  • Understanding of the matters that are impacting First Nations peoples and a commitment to continue to develop cultural capability
  • Ability to manage time, set priorities, plan, and organise own work
  • Experience in building relationships to influence mutually beneficial outcomes with internal and external stakeholders
  • A relevant degree or diploma course with little or no relevant work experience, or through lesser formal qualifications with relevant work skills, or through relevant experience and work skills commensurate with the requirements of this position
  • A current employee Working with Children Check, or willingness to obtain
  • A continuous improvement mindset with a positive, proactive, and flexible attitude.
